7. Add value to your content
This is perhaps the most important creative writing tip. After all, have you ever stopped to analyze what leads us to share content on social media , in general?
People share content that creates value for themselves and others. But what does that mean? In other words, adding value to your content is a way to give people a way to look better while promoting your ideas.
Therefore, one of the essential creative writing tips is based on humanized texts , which capture the reader's attention about who you are and what you have experienced. Therefore, it is very important to tell your experiences, with examples, to show your vulnerability and victories. After all, with this you can transmit real learnings to readers and create a unique identity in your texts.
